Entrance Exams and Admissions

  • Admissions in Institute of Management Education are based on 12th marks, CAT and personal interviews.

Academics and Faculty

5

  • The classes at Institute of Management Education start from 9:15 am and ends at 2:00 pm.
  • Teaching quality is very good.

Fees and Scholarships

5

  • The fee at Institute of Management Education is 60,000rs per year (include uniform) it contains two semesters.
  • No loan is not needed because the fee is not that high.

Clubs and Associations

5

  • There are various clubs in Institute of Management Education which are formed by responsible students like protocol committee, disciplined committee, sports committee, etc. The main festival of our college is the Manthan (college foundation day), annual festival, various co-curricular activities etc.
